Re: Stripped alternator cap threads
How'd they strip???
Flywheel bolts have been known to back out and push the cap out. One time, the cap didn't give and the whole rear cover cracked.
Anyway, there may be something else going on.
Or just possibly, you did it yourself? (and if that was me...I'd just sit quietly in a corner while replacing the rear cover).

Re: Stripped alternator cap threads
Honda uses that same cap on lots of bikes and places. I have seen two or three that when being removed it galled/seized and boogered the threads badly and made installing another terribly hard. I do not know what the diameter and thread pitch are but a thread chaser could be created by a good machinist with thread cutting lathe. But it would have to be very short and compact.
